KotorArt Academy for music and theater professionals is a new segment of the KotorArt International Festival, designed to offer producers and cultural managers a comprehensive overview of various activities in the performing arts field, with a specific focus on music and theater. 

KotorArt Academy for music and theater professionals will take place from July 24th to July 29th, 2024, in Kotor, as part of the KotorArt International Festival program. This year's experts and lecturers of the Academy include: Gabrielle Bernoville, Policy Assistant of the Creative Europe Programme of the European Commission, Jan Briers, President of the European Festivals Association (EFA), Katherine Haataja, CEO and Founder of the Operosa Montenegro Opera Festival, Sophie Vanden Broeck, Assistant to the Managing Director for International Expansion at the NTGent theater, and tour producer for performances of Jan Fabre and Milo Rau, Dubravka Vrgoč, dramaturge and intendant of the Croatian National Theatre Ivan pl. Zajc in Rijeka, Jelena Janković-Beguš and Milica Kadić, Program managers of the Belgrade Festival Centre (CEBEF) and Producers of BEMUS, Anica Tomić, theater director and actress, and Sara Mandić, Development and Production manager of the KotorArt International Festival.

The Academy program will offer participants an overview of various forms of engagement in music and performing arts through the aspects of international cooperation. The focus will be on artistic as well as production, administrative, financial, and legal issues in both regional and European contexts.

Selected participants will attend expert lectures on various production and co-production models, financing and support mechanisms, sustainability in music and performing arts, as well as strategies for tours and accessing foreign markets. Workshops with selected mentors will enable participants to develop and refine their projects and focus on practical work. Part of the program will involve familiarizing participants with different modalities of regional and international cooperation, as well as networking opportunities with other professionals in the field. 

The program will also be enriched by performances, concerts, and other events presented as part of the XXIII KotorArt International Festival, along with daily discussions on jointly envisioned programs.


WHO ARE WE SEEKING AND WHAT IS OFFERED TO SELECTED CANDIDATES?

 

The Call is open to theater and music professionals aged up to 35 with experience in production and organization. 
Selected candidates will have their registration fees and accommodation costs fully covered in Kotor during the Academy, including access to KotorArt programs. Selected candidates are responsible for organizing and covering their own travel expenses

HOW TO APPLY? 

To apply, please complete the online form available at THIS link no later than April 28, 2023. 

The online form must be filled out in English and, in addition to providing the applicant's CV and basic information, it should also include a brief description of the project/initiative (up to 2 pages in A4 format). It is recommended that the project/initiative description covers the following categories: project/initiative title, objectives, target groups, sustainability of the project/initiative (including potential social and economic value and innovative aspects), as well as information about partnerships or collaborations related to the proposed project or initiative.

Projects will be evaluated by an Expert Jury composed of renowned professionals from the fields of theater and music production, as well as cultural and creative industries from the Western Balkan countries. Selected candidates will be notified via email after the selection process is completed.
